A basque is a close-fitting bodice, extending from the shoulders to approximately waist level. It may have attached suspenders, and is often worn with a matching pair of knickers or a thong.

Unlike a corset, it is not designed to constrain the figure.

Basques are usually made of satin, but may be in a wide range of materials, such as PVC or see-through nylon. Sometimes they have a mixture of areas, opaque over the breasts and see-through in most other places.
